Break-glass access: SquatWatch

Quick notes for the weekly sync. SquatWatch is our typo-squatting package scanner; if it goes dark, malicious lookalike packages can slip into the Pellbrook registry, so we keep a break-glass path. Use it only when both regular admins are unreachable and the scanner has been down 30+ minutes. Grab the sealed envelope from the ops locker, log the incident in #squatwatch-alerts, and ping whoever's on call. The break-glass login prompts for the passphrase below.

unlock words, tagaf-tawif: quenys-zordor-aldius-caswyn

## Env Vars — Password Reset Revamp (Fernwick Auth)

Quick notes for the sync. The new reset flow moves token signing out of the app layer into the Larkspur service. All reset links now expire in 15 minutes, not 24 hours. Staging is already cut over; prod follows Thursday.

Three vars changed: RESET_TOKEN_TTL, RESET_BASE_URL, and the signing secret. The first two are in the shared config repo. The signing secret must be set locally in each node's env file, as follows.

env line for fafof-fahag: LEDGER_TOKEN5=f8790

**Ticket KIOSK-WATCHDOG: Vault locked after watchdog restart loop**

The Perchline kiosk watchdog restarted the shell eleven times overnight, which tripped the credential vault's tamper lock. This is by design: repeated restarts look like tampering. Future maintainers, do not wipe the vault — telemetry history lives there. To unlock it safely, open the recovery prompt on the kiosk and enter the passphrase below.

vault phrase of tajop-haduf = holath-brivan-wenax

Account recovery — export memory note. When a locked Pellwick account requires a full spreadsheet export for identity review, do not run it on the shared worker pool. The Tabulist exporter loads the entire sheet into memory; accounts over 200k rows will OOM the node. Use the dedicated recovery host instead, with streaming mode enabled. Cap concurrent exports at two. If the host itself is locked after a failed drill, restore access via the recovery console. Enter the passphrase printed below when prompted.

vault phrase of kafog-kahif = holdor-rusir-praox